BENJANI Mwaruwari will be under a lot of focus today when Highlanders host FC Platinum in a Good Friday Castle Lager Premiership match at Barbourfields.

Yesterday, Benjani stunned the media when he went ballistic to reveal that he feels there are some individuals who have been sabotaging his reign at Bosso. He is angry with the club’s failure to secure a work permit for Zambian forward Isaac Lunga, who has now spent over a month without getting the documentation.

“I think I should now go public, you know sometimes you have to have full support but I’m starting to see some negative things.

“As a team we need to push together, pull in one direction, we need to work so hard. The boys are pushing, I’m pushing but somehow, somewhere, there is a problem.

“I will be honest,” said Benjani.

Who is really wants to bury The Undertaker at Bosso?

“I needed maximum support, but I feel like that is not happening. I don’t know maybe there are individuals who are not fully behind this project.

“It is difficult to understand how a work permit can take more than a month.”

The coach hinted at deeper issues within the club, raising concerns about possible resistance to his tenure. “I am beginning to notice certain things that seem to work against what we are trying to achieve as a team. That is not helpful, especially when we are trying to move forward.

“I know that many people did not want me here, but that will not stop me from giving my best for this club. My focus remains on improving the team and delivering results.”
